プラウツール Oracle接続エラー解決方法【原因と対策】

PL/SQLがOracleデータベースに接続できない場合は、以下の方法を試すことができます。

  1. ネットワーク接続をチェックしてください:データベースサーバーとクライアントマシンの間のネットワーク接続が正常であることを確認し、データベースサーバーのIPアドレスまたはホスト名にpingを送信してネットワーク接続を確認してください。
  2. リスナーの状態を確認してください:Oracleデータベースのリスナーサービスが実行されていることを確認し、lsnrctl statusコマンドを使用してリスナーの状態を調べてください。もしリスナーが実行されていない場合は、リスナーを起動してください。
  3. データベースインスタンスの状態をチェックしてください。Oracleデータベースインスタンスが正常に稼働していることを確認し、sqlplusを使用してデータベースインスタンスに接続し、「select status from v$instance;」コマンドを使用してデータベースインスタンスの状態を確認してください。
  4. 接続文字列を確認してください:PL/SQLでデータベースに接続する際に使用する接続文字列が正しいかどうか、ホスト名、ポート番号、サービス名またはSIDなどの情報を含めて確認してください。
  5. 防火壁の設定を確認し、PL/SQLがデータベースサーバーへのポート通信をブロックしていないことを確認してください。
  6. データベースアカウントの権限を確認してください:PL/SQLがデータベースに接続するためのアカウントが、データベースに接続し、必要な操作を実行するための十分な権限を持っていることを確認してください。

上記の方法が問題を解決できない場合は、データベースサービスを再起動するか、クライアントマシンを再起動して問題を解決してみてください。問題が解決しない場合は、データベース管理者やOracle公式サポートに連絡して、さらなるサポートを受けることを検討してください。

bannerAds